“The COVID-19 outbreak has raised the demand for cooking oil as part of the shift from dining out to cooking at home, which has accelerated the growth in the retail market of cooking oil. Consumers’ special attention to nutrients and tendency to switch between oil types indicates that brands should optimise their product portfolio by focusing on healthier oil types and offering upgraded versions of traditional oil types to meet ...

Mintel runs online consumer research in ten cities, completing 300 interviews per city with a total sample size of 3,000. Our consumer research is based on a random sample of internet respondents from a panel recruited by KuRunData China online research.
